Web hosting is a vital aspect of any website’s infrastructure. It allows users to store their website files and access them via the internet. However, web hosting can also be considered a type of Software as a Service (SaaS). In this article, we will explore whether web hosting qualifies as SaaS and its implications for web developers.
What is Software as a Service (SaaS)?
Software as a Service (SaaS) is a model of software delivery where a third-party provider hosts and manages the software, making it accessible to users over the internet. The software is typically accessed via web browsers or mobile applications, and users do not need to install any software on their devices.
Advantages of SaaS
SaaS offers several advantages, including:
- Scalability: SaaS providers can easily scale the amount of resources needed to host a particular application, making it more cost-effective than managing hardware or infrastructure in-house.
- Accessibility: SaaS applications are accessible from anywhere with an internet connection, making them ideal for remote work and collaboration.
- Security: SaaS providers typically have robust security measures in place to protect their customers’ data, including encryption, access controls, and regular backups.
- Maintenance: SaaS providers handle all maintenance and updates for the software, freeing up users from the responsibility of managing their own infrastructure.
Web Hosting as SaaS
Web hosting can be considered a type of SaaS because it involves a third-party provider hosting and managing website files and databases on behalf of customers. Web hosts typically provide a variety of services, including domain name registration, website builders, and security tools. These services are hosted on servers located in data centers, allowing customers to access their websites via the internet.
Advantages of Web Hosting as SaaS
Web hosting as SaaS offers several advantages, including:
- Simplicity: Web hosts provide an easy-to-use platform for managing website files and databases, allowing users to focus on creating content rather than managing infrastructure.
- Cost-effectiveness: Web hosts typically offer shared hosting plans that allow multiple customers to share the same server resources, reducing costs compared to dedicated hosting.
- Scalability: Web hosts can easily scale the amount of resources needed to host a particular website, making it more cost-effective than managing hardware or infrastructure in-house.
- Security: Web hosts typically have robust security measures in place to protect their customers’ data, including encryption, access controls, and regular backups.
Web Hosting vs. SaaS Providers
While web hosting can be considered a type of SaaS, it is important to differentiate between web hosts and SaaS providers. Web hosts typically provide infrastructure services, while SaaS providers offer software-based solutions.
When choosing between a web host and a SaaS provider, consider the following factors:
- Customization: SaaS providers typically offer limited customization options, while web hosts may allow customers to configure their servers as needed.
- Integration: SaaS providers often integrate with other software tools, while web hosts typically do not offer this functionality.
- Scalability: SaaS providers may have more robust scalability features than web hosts, allowing for faster deployment and easier management of applications.
- Cost: Web hosts and SaaS providers may have different pricing models, with web hosts offering shared hosting plans and SaaS providers charging monthly or annual subscription fees.
Case Study: WordPress as a SaaS Platform
WordPress is one of the most popular website management platforms in the world, with over 60 million websites currently using it.